We hear and see the time the memes about getting up and trying again.  One of my favorites is that you are not a failure until you stop getting up again.  We also hear everywhere that this year has been a hard and trying one.  Many are anxious for it to end.

In just a few hours the new year will begin on the other side of the world.  Drinks will be hoisted.  Kisses will be exchanged.  Resolutions will be vowed and shared.  Over the next twelve days most of those resolutions will be broken.  It is one of the many ways we fall.  We will fall and fail and fracture.  It is the nature of humans.

When we choose not to get up is when we are in danger.  It is in those failures that cause us to quit that we really lose.  The choice never to quit is one that no one can take from us.  When we quit on each other we do it out of choice.  We can justify it all that we want to salve our conscience.  We can redefine what we have said to make it seem like it allowable to treat others with less than love and respect.  All we are resolving is our own rationalization. 

We know what is best for us.  We know what we should be and how we should act.  Instead we fall into habits that salve our pain and hinder our progress.  We dream and talk but we do not move toward deeper love and stronger peace.  I am working at both.  I have a long way to go and situations and other humans keep knocking me down but I will keep getting up.

I think there Is not a day where I do not fall in some way.  It is getting up that will allow me to keep following; moving.   It is getting up no matter how painful it hurts to do it that will put me in the right way to reach my destination.  So, I dare you to move by getting up.  I dare to keep loving, keep working at peace, keep showing mercy and grace Dear Reader. 

You may feel you cannot get up.  Yes, you can.  Even if there is a moment where you really cannot Jesus promise is to carry you if necessary.  We believe we cannot more often than is true.  We do not get up because it seems more comfortable to stay in our old familiar pain.  As we close the year, I dare you to move.  Tell me about it so that I may walk with you.
